The Basics of Pounds and Kilograms



What is a Pound?


The pound, symbolized as lb, is a unit of mass originally used in the imperial and customary systems of measurement. Its origins trace back to Roman times, where it was based on a unit called the libra, from which the abbreviation "lb" derives. In the United States and some other countries, the pound remains the standard unit for measuring body weight, food, and other commodities.

The modern international avoirdupois pound is officially defined as exactly 0.45359237 kilograms. The avoirdupois system is a weight measurement system based on a pound of 16 ounces, which is different from the troy system used for precious metals.

What is a Kilogram?


The kilogram (kg) is the base unit of mass in the International System of Units (SI). It was originally defined in 1795 as the mass of one liter (cubic decimeter) of water. Today, the kilogram is defined by a physical constant: the Planck constant, thanks to the efforts of the International Bureau of Weights and Measures (BIPM).

The kilogram is widely used across the globe for scientific, commercial, and everyday measurements. Its standardization ensures consistency and accuracy in measurement systems worldwide.

The Conversion Formula Between Pounds and Kilograms



The conversion from pounds to kilograms hinges on the precise relationship:


  • 1 pound (lb) = 0.45359237 kilograms (kg)



To convert any number of pounds to kilograms, multiply that number by the conversion factor.

Mathematical formula:

\[ \text{Weight in kg} = \text{Weight in lbs} \times 0.45359237 \]

Applying this to 3000 pounds:

\[ 3000 \times 0.45359237 = \text{Weight in kg} \]

Calculating:

\[ 3000 \times 0.45359237 = 1360.77611 \text{ kg} \]

Thus,

3000 pounds equals approximately 1360.78 kilograms.

Historical Context and Evolution of Measurement Systems



Understanding the history of pounds and kilograms offers insight into how these units have evolved and their significance in global measurement systems.

The Imperial and US Customary Systems


The pound originated from the Roman libra, which was a unit of weight used centuries ago. The imperial system, developed in Britain, standardized the pound in the 19th century. The US customary system adopted similar standards, leading to the modern pound used today.

The Metric System and the Kilogram


The metric system was developed in France during the late 18th century with the goal of creating a universal and rational system of measurement. The kilogram became the fundamental unit of mass, defined initially by a platinum-iridium alloy cylinder stored in France. Today, it is defined by a fundamental constant, ensuring its stability over time.

Transition and Standardization


The transition from customary units to metric units has been gradual but steady worldwide. Many countries adopt the metric system as their official measurement system, making conversions like pounds to kilograms more relevant for international trade, science, and daily life.
